Six Rococo Sèvres Style Porcelain Plates
About the Item
Each porcelain plate in this set of six features a navy-blue ground, distinctive to works produced in the style of Sèvres, and gilded rims with ornate patterns inscribed. The centre of each plate is painted with a portrayal of hunting, the manner belonging to the period of Louis XV. The painted scenes on each plate are signed ‘WOUVEMANS’, while the back of each plate is marked with the Sèvres insignia.
